Chemicals & Minerals
Showing 28–36 of 89 results
-

ALL-IN-ONE DESIGN RLA-6K
Contact Us -

Annual output of 120,000 tons of DMF, 20,000 tons of NMF project – waste liquid and waste gas incineration treatment system
Contact Us -

BG3SI21
Contact Us -

BG3SI21
Contact Us




